In ROMANCE-ology 101, Award-winning “Passion Most Pure” expert Julie Lessman tackles the subject of romantic tension in today’s inspirational/sweet markets with humor and heart. Offering tips for ramping up the WOW factor with romance that is both sweet and swoon-worthy, Lessman highlights tried-and-true methods with before-and-after examples to illustrate the following points: -- Getting inside the Hero’s Head with Internal Monologue -- Maximizing Use of Beats in Dialogue -- Effectively Using Dialogue to Escalate Tension -- Utilizing Dual Point of View -- Escalating Romantic Tension with Anger -- Using All Five Senses for Heightened Effect -- Cashing In on the Kid and Pet Factor -- Enhancing Mood with Emotionally Charged Words/Verbs -- Capitalizing on the Element of Surprise -- Exposing Desire in an Unwilling Character -- Immediate Hero/Heroine Confrontation -- Making the Most of Touch and Response -- Implementing the Concept of Forbidden Fruit -- Words with a Hint of Taboo -- Appropriate “Bleep” Words for Inspirational Romance -- KISS-ology 101: The Many Faces of a Kiss TESTIMONIALS: "Julie is one of the best there is today at writing intensely passionate romance novels. Rape culture is alive and well in America.Lessman has a quick wit and easy style, which makes this book an easy read. Her tips range from the useful (utilize the hero's POV, not just the heroine's) to the basic (use action "beats" instead of dialogue tags) to the disturbing ( use "anger" and "unwillingness" to create romantic tension). She gives a nod towards political correctness ("domestic abuse and date rape are a real problem"), but the examples she uses to illustrate her tips seem to indicate that not only is aggressive male behavior acceptable but it's romantic and desirable. There's a lot of grabbing wrists, pulling her roughly to him, crushing her mouth, dominating, and yielding. I don't know about you, but I don't feel like kissing when I'm angry, and if some guy kisses me when I don't want him to, he's getting a knee to the groin and slapped with a restraining order. It's time that we stop teaching women, and especially young women, that this kind of behavior is healthy and acceptable.I downloaded this book because I wanted to add romance to my stories. I was hoping to find tips on how to create a full range of emotions surrounding a kiss: tenderness, respect, shyness, vulnerability, love, and soul sharing. There's enough physical lust in our entertainment these days. And yet, that's all that Lessman focuses on. Her tips are intended to turn up the heat without ever "going there." If that is all that you want to do, then you will find this book helpful. However, I was hoping for more from this book. If you want examples of authors who do sweet romance in a healthier way, I would recommend Georgette Heyer or Sarah M. Eden.I recommend this book if you are a critical thinker who can separate the good information from the bad. Otherwise, don't bother.
